Oct is a month of transition in Ngorongoro Crater. The start of your month is the peak of the prolonged dry year, and far from the crater flooring resembles a barren dust bowl of good volcanic soil, whilst what grass continues to be are going to be lower and yellowing, making it straightforward to place bigger predators, although grazers tend to congregate close to the number of remaining sources of consuming drinking water. the primary in the short rains ordinarily slide to the tip of October, supplying welcome alleviation to the dryness, but not likely affect negatively on tourist things to do.

Your safari guidebook will most likely remain by the vehicle for the duration of your visit. A village elder, who invariably speaks fantastic English, is going to be your information throughout your take a look at. You will be invited right into a residence, and revealed how the community life, eats and sleeps. queries are welcomed.
